Color Science For Kids - 0 views

  • Disappearing Color Science Experiment Color Combination Science
    • Mary Miller
       
      This activity should be introduced with a discussion about the properties of light.  The teacher could talk about why rainbows are all different colors or use a prism to show how light can be broken into all different colors.  A short video on the topic might work well for this topic as well, if you can find a good one.  By the end of the initial introduction, students should understand that all different colors of light, when combined, create white light.  Then students will be introduced to the experiment, write their predictions in their science notebooks, conduct the experiment, and record their findings. 4.NS.4 Perform investigations using appropriate tools and technologies that will extend the senses. 5.NS.7 Keep accurate records in a notebook during investigations and communicate findings to others using graphs, charts, maps and models through oral and written reports. Like most experiments, student capabilities should be taken into consideration. If they cannot handle conducting this experiment on their own or with a small group, they can observe another student's or the teacher's experiment.
  •  
    This is a very hands-on activity that would be good as a supplement to a science lesson, but may not work so well on its own.  It could be used as a fun activity for family science or some other sort of science fair as well.  In this activity, students create colored disks and attach them to strings.  When spun rapidly, the colored disks appear to be white and have no color.  This would be a great introduction to learning about the properties of light, and how white light is really comprised of all the different colors.  A prism would be a helpful add-on to this lesson as well.

Lesson Plans: Growing Lima Beans (3-5, Science) - 0 views

  • Growing Lima Beans
  • All right guys, if you had fun doing this activity today you can try your own experiment at home. You can do this activity with different types of seeds. You can also do the potato suspended in water as well as the carrot top grown in soil.
    • Mary Miller
       
      An extension for this activity would be to have students who seem to be enjoying it but are moving ahead of the group try the growing experiment with different plants.  These students could then compare the lima bean growth to that of other plants. Students who are struggling, or maybe who have had a plant die could work together in groups and share plants to observe and experiment with. 4.NS.7 Keep accurate records in a notebook during investigations and communicate findings to others using graphs, charts, maps and models through oral and written reports. 4.3.4 Describe a way that a given plant or animal might adapt to a change arising from a human or non-human impact on its environment.
  •  
    This site shows what should be included on student worksheets for this activity, and it also tells you what you should be doing every day for this unit of study.  This allows students to see first-hand the different parts of plants and to observe plant growth as it happens.  I like that it includes both dissection of the seed, or plant embryo, and growth of a plant.  Students should use their science notebooks to record the stages of growth of the plants and to make scientific drawings of what they see.

Air pressure for kids | Science Sparks - 1 views

    • Mary Miller
       
      This activity should be done as an experiment in class.  This means that students should make a prediction about how the match will heat the air and affect the egg.  Students will write down their predictions in their science notebooks.  They should also draw pictures and make notes about what is happening in their science notebooks.  All students will be expected to participate in this activity and take notes, make predictions, draw pictures, and describe whether or not their predictions were correct.  Adaptations could be made for students with special needs by allowing them to express themselves more with pictures than words, and giving them additional time to complete their work. 5.NS.1 Make predictions and formulate testable questions 5.NS.7 Keep accurate records in a notebook during investigations and communicate findings to others using graphs, charts, maps, and models through oral and written reports.
  •  
    This experiment shows how air pressure works by heating up air to make an egg fit into a bottle that it should not be able to.  The egg is first placed on top of the bottle to show that it does not fit through (the bottle should be large enough for the egg to fit through for the experiment, though, so it should be tested ahead of time).  Then a match is dropped in the bottle, heating the air, and forcing the egg through the hole and into the bottle.  This is a fun way to teach about air pressure and the effects of heating air.
